What is the object of Stylistics? What does Stylistics deal with?(the problem of the definition of the term “style”).

Although the term style is used very frequently in Literary Criticism and especially Stylistics, it is very difficult to define. There are several broad areas in which it is used.

The following table offers a summary of the most common definitions of style and the most influential approaches in stylistic studies as listed by K. Wales (Кatie Wales - Nottingham-based linguist) in her respected work A Dictionary of Stylistics (1990):

DEFINITIONS OF STYLE
Style can be seen as ► the manner of expressionin writing and speaking ►from the point of view of ‘language in use’ as a variation, i.e. speakers use different styles in different situations, literary v non-literary (register - systemic variations in non-literary situations: advertising, legal language, sports commentary, etc.). Styles may vary also according to medium (spoken, written) and degree of formality (termed also style-shifting) ►the setor sumof linguistic features ►a choiceof items ►deviationfrom a norm (e.g. marked poetic idiolects, common approach in the 1960s) ► a literary genre(classical style; realistic style; the style of romanticism).

(1) At its simplest, style refers to the manner of expression in writing and speaking, just as there is a manner of doing things, like playing squash or painting.

We might talk of someone writing in an ornate style, or speaking in a comic style. For some people style has evaluative connotations: style can be good or bad.

1. There is a widely held view that style is the correspondence between thought and expression. The linguistic form of the idea expressed always reflects the peculiarities of the thought. And vice versa, the character of the thought will always in a greater or lesser degree manifest itself in the language forms chosen for the expression of the idea.
